Neill — First Edition First Printing 1931 HC with All 12 Colored Plates Intact — RARE Publisher: Reilly and Lee Company, 1931Rare, first edition, first printing copy of Ruth Plumly Thompson's "Pirates in OZ" with all 12 colored plates intact. The boards and binding are solid and tight, save some shelf-wear on spine ends and corners. The pages are crisp and generally clean save for spots of discoloration on pages 87-89, and 180-181. The 12 colored plates are crisp, clear and in excellent condition. The beginnings of minor page separation to front board's corresponding page which has been secured by a piece of tape. DescriptionPeter returns to Oz for a third time, this time w/Captain Samuel Salt/his pirates on the Nonestic Ocean (surrounding the landmass of Oz/neighbor countries); Old Ruggedo, the Gnome King has returned, cursed w/a Silence Stone, deciding to answer an ad for King of Menankypoo (whose people communicate w/words appearing on their foreheads), demanding a voiceless king; Soon he becomes leader of a band of pirates and rebels, attempting once again to conquer Oz.
